With the gentle lope of his rhythms and the plainspoken phrasing of his material, Don Williams sings country music of unmatched simplicity and purity. His love songs are as straightforward as their titles--"I Wouldn't Want to Live If You Didn't Love Me," "You're My Best Friend," "I Believe in You"--delivered in a warm baritone that makes his singing seem as natural as breathing. "Tulsa Time," a country chart-topper, might be more familiar to rock fans through the cover by Eric Clapton, one of Williams's devoted fans. Though some of the early-'70s selections suffer from overproduction, and so many of the hits sound so much the same, the collection attests to Williams's enduring appeal. (Major omission: his "If I Needed You" duet with Emmylou Harris.) --Don McLeese

This collection of 20 of Don's greatest hits is a great collection for all fans of the smooth side of country music and for fans of great storytelling, which is what country music at its best basically is. Every song speaks for itself. While most of the songs on here feature his smooth side, "Tulsa Time" may get the fan out on the dance floor doing the two step or the "Slappin' Leather" line dance. Don's interpretation of "Amanda" (which was later a #1 hit for Waylon Jennings) is as good as anything else he has done and is very heart-wrenching. Smooth country music back in the 1970's doesn't get much better than this, so this collection is a must have for your collection.
